Mauro Icardi has rejected a move to Arsenal after Inter tried to swap him for the Gunners’ forward Pierre Emerick-Aubameyang, according to Sport Mediaset.
The Nerazzurri’s former captain has flown to Ibiza this weekend where he will meet wife Wanda Nara, having trained alone at Appiano Gentile since Tuesday.
Juventus remain interested in signing the forward but Icardi has given them a deadline of 10 August to make their move.
Napoli have also been linked with the 26-year-old but he appears to be giving preference to the Bianconeri for now.
Elsewhere, Inter are hoping to make a breakthrough in their talks with Roma for Edin Dzeko and have prepared a €13 million offer for the Giallorossi.
Romelu Lukaku remains a primary target as well and Manchester United will soon receive a bid worth €60 million plus €15 million in bonuses.
Dalbert and Joao Mario are both due to head the other way, but Inter have no clubs currently interested in either player.
